What is an observatory?

An observatory is a facility or location equipped with instruments for observing astronomical, meteorological, or other natural phenomena. Most often, observatories are associated with telescopes used to study stars, planets, and other objects in space. Some observatories also monitor Earth's atmosphere, weather, or seismic activity. They can be ground-based or space-based and play an essential role in scientific research and discovery.

What are the key skills and qualifications needed to thrive as an observatory technician, and why are they important?

To thrive as an Observatory Technician, you need a background in physics, astronomy, or engineering, along with hands-on experience in instrumentation and observatory operations. Familiarity with telescope control systems, data acquisition software, and possibly certifications in electronics or optics is typically required. Strong problem-solving skills, attention to detail, and effective communication are essential soft skills for collaborating with scientists and ensuring optimal equipment performance. These skills are crucial to maintaining precise observations, supporting research activities, and ensuring the efficient functioning of observatory facilities.

What are some common challenges faced by professionals working at an observatory, and how can they be addressed?

Professionals at observatories often face challenges such as working irregular hours due to nighttime observations, maintaining complex equipment in remote locations, and adapting to rapidly changing weather conditions that can affect data collection. Effective communication and teamwork are crucial, as observatory staff often collaborate with researchers, engineers, and support personnel. Addressing these challenges typically involves strong organizational skills, ongoing technical training, and flexibility to adapt to unexpected situations, ensuring both the safety and success of observational projects.

Job description

Senior Electrical Controls EngineerSearch Leaders, LLC Plymouth, Minnesota, United States About this position

Our client delivers custom mechanization and integrated engineering solutions for complex, one-of-a-kind structures and attractions across aerospace, entertainment, stadium, observatory, and specialty crane applications.

Position Responsibilities:

This senior engineering role leads the development and execution of sophisticated electrical control systems while building the leadership, project management, and team coordination capabilities needed for advancement into engineering management.

  • Lead concept development and engineering design for complex electrical control systems.
  • Direct and contribute to design documentation, schematics, electrical panel design, PLC and HMI programming, field installation, and project commissioning.
  • Foster a collaborative engineering environment centered on accountability, continuous improvement, professional development, and knowledge sharing.
  • Coordinate across engineering disciplines, project management teams, and external stakeholders to support successful project delivery.
  • Develop and maintain departmental processes that align engineering practices with industry standards and quality expectations.
  • Drive initiatives that improve team efficiency, control costs, and strengthen the quality of engineering deliverables.
  • Support project budgeting, scheduling, and scope management while maintaining alignment with client expectations.
  • Guide engineers on system architecture, design reviews, and technology and tool adoption.
  • Provide technical leadership during field commissioning, system startup, and ongoing maintenance activities.
  • Establish and maintain departmental procedures that support broader organizational objectives.

Management Track

  • This senior engineering role is designed for an experienced controls engineer who wants to continue leading complex technical work while developing the leadership, project management, and team coordination capabilities needed for advancement into an Engineering Manager role.

Position requirements:

  • Must qualify as a U.S. person under ITAR requirements due to access to export-controlled technical data.
  • B.S. degree from an ABET-accredited institution in Electrical Engineering, Systems Engineering, Computer Engineering, or equivalent control system design and programming skills.
  • 10+ years of electrical controls experience with a bachelor’s degree or 7+ years with a master’s degree.
  • Demonstrated design expertise with PLCs, HMIs, VFDs, servo systems, and motor controllers.
  • Proven leadership capabilities, including mentoring, coaching, and developing engineers across experience levels.
  • Ability to cultivate a collaborative, accountable, innovative, and continuous-learning team environment.
  • Experience leading cross-functional teams while maintaining organizational alignment and driving successful project delivery.
  • Strong analytical and logical problem-solving capabilities with an aptitude for developing innovative technical solutions.
  • Ability to research, integrate, and apply emerging technologies to unprecedented engineering challenges with minimal oversight.
  • Strong understanding of team dynamics with the ability to remove obstacles and facilitate effective communication across departments.
  • Ability to lead by example while maintaining high standards for ethics, quality, safety, and schedule performance.
  • Willingness to travel domestically and internationally for project installation and commissioning, approximately 5–10% of the time.

Preferred Requirements:

  • M.S. degree from an ABET-accredited institution in Electrical Engineering, Systems Engineering, or Computer Engineering.
  • Professional Engineer (P.E.) registration.
  • Proficiency with Rockwell and Siemens controls hardware and software.
  • Proficiency with AutoCAD, Eplan, or comparable electrical drafting software.

Reasons to Apply:

  • Competitive salary plus a comprehensive benefits package.
  • Health coverage, retirement plans, and other company-sponsored perks.
  • Generous paid time off, including holidays, to support work-life balance.
  • Flexible schedules and work life balance.
  • Strong focus on employee development with on-the-job training and career growth.
  • A positive company culture that values diversity and collaboration.
